What is 510 threading?

The 510 threading is an industry standard, and it is named after the battery’s core threading, which has a diameter of 5mm and 10 threads. The number 10 refers to the thread count circling the central pin. A 510 thread battery is a battery that can fit the majority of tanks and cartridges commonly associated with vaporizers.

Types of 510 Batteries:

There are many different types of 510 batteries on the market today. One of the most popular types of 510 batteries is the variable voltage battery. This type of battery comes with a voltage dial to adjust the intensity of your vape clouds. Another popular choice is the buttonless vape battery, which only requires inhaling to activate. It is a popular choice among beginners and those who want a more discreet vaping experience. Both options come in different sizes and colors, but it is essential to look for features such as battery life, charging time, and compatibility options before making a purchase.

How to choose the right 510 battery:

Choosing a 510 battery can be overwhelming, but there are specific considerations to keep in mind. First, think about the device you will be using it with. This is important for compatibility reasons. You will also want to consider the size and weight of the battery, especially if you intend to carry it with you. A larger battery may have more power and longer battery life, but it may not be as portable. Finally, consider the battery’s output power and capacity, which affect the intensity of your vape clouds and how long the battery will last. A 510 battery with a higher power output and capacity will provide more intense vaping experiences and longer battery life.

Tips for maximizing your 510 battery:

To get the most from your 510 battery, it is essential to take care of it properly. Always charge your battery fully before using it for the first time. In most cases, it is recommended to keep your battery charged between 30-70% to prevent overcharging and prolong battery life. It can be tempting to vape continuously, but it is best to take breaks in between sessions to prevent the battery from overheating or wearing out too quickly. Finally, store your battery in a cool, dry place to prolong its lifespan.
